NEW five part drama starting next week and on Monday to Friday

It is set in a French village called Saint Michael - Joanna Scanlon Plays single mother Sarah, who received a late night call from her teen daughter Katie who then vanishes on a school exchange

When a frantic Sarah arrived in France, she is shocked at the indifference towards her daughter Katie ‘s disappearance

Rupert Graves plays Jason who drove the exchange students to France

Robert lindsy is a mysterious X expat Andrew

Lieutenant Virginia Taylor, is a local detective who makes it her mission to help Sarah find Katie
